Asian Markets: Drivers of Global Industry Dynamics

2 hours ago 586

The rapid evolution of Asian markets is reshaping the global industry landscape, causing a ripple effect that has gained the attention of business leaders worldwide. The latest findings from a comprehensive study reveal the complex network of influences that Asian industries, particularly in technology, exert on the international market. As consumers’ tastes continue to evolve, companies must swiftly adapt to preserve their competitive position. Specialists stress the importance of strategic market positioning to effectively navigate these transformations.

What Insights Does the Study Provide?

The research carried out by a respected firm provides significant insight into the critical role of Asian markets in shaping the global industrial arena. The study highlights how technological innovations emerging from Asia are impacting sectors ranging from automotive to consumer electronics. The data underscores a significant rise in export figures, establishing the region as a formidable force in the global economy.

How Are Businesses Adjusting?

To address these shifts, numerous international corporations are revisiting their corporate strategies to adopt more nimble and flexible business models. A representative commented,

“Our aim is to synchronize our operations with Asia’s rapid growth, seizing new opportunities.”

This strategic shift is deemed necessary to sustain a leading position in a fiercely competitive market.

Furthermore, the wave of innovations from Asia is prompting Western enterprises to boost their research and development initiatives. Various collaborative ventures are in progress, targeting the integration of technological advancements into existing products. This initiative is essential for staying relevant and tapping into the latest technologies.

Industry insights forecast that Asian market influence will persist as new trade-friendly policies bolster global commerce. The heightened emphasis on sustainable practices also features prominently, driven by regulatory and corporate efforts toward greener methodologies.

Despite these advancements, challenges remain, necessitating creative solutions. Businesses contend with supply chain complexities and regulatory demands. Reflecting on these hurdles, a sector expert noted,

“Successfully navigating these intricate environments demands adaptability and foresight.”

The future trajectory of the global market hinges on the ongoing interaction between tech progressions and regional economic policies. As the landscape continues to change, companies are expected to stay alert, developing adaptive strategies and international partnerships. With Asia maintaining its stride toward technological preeminence, the potential for global economic expansion seems promising.
